DirectXについての疑問:ダウンロード方法とManaged DirectXの特徴

このQ&Aのポイント
  • 日本語WindowsのPCでManaged DirectXをダウンロードする際の言語の選び方について説明してください。
  • Managed DirectXとは、DirectXの.Net対応版であることがわかりましたが、どのバージョンが該当するのか確認する方法について教えてください。
  • Managed DirectXはマイクロソフトのダウンロードセンターから入手できます。詳細な情報は公式サイトをご覧ください。
回答を見る
  • ベストアンサー

DirectXについて

海外で開発されたソフトウェアを使っています。動作環境に"Managed DirectX"が必要、とあります。これがよくわかりません。 1.私自身は日本語WindowsのPCを使っているのですが、マイクロソフトのダウンロードセンターを見ると、英語ページからダウンロードした場合、バージョンがまったく同じでも日本語ページからダウンロードしたものとファイルのサイズが違います。 この場合、英語ページ/日本語ページのどちらからダウンロードしたものを使うべきでしょうか? (つまり、DirectXの言語はOS/アプリのどちらにあわせるべきかと言う事です。) 2."Managed" というのが気になってネットで調べたら、DirectXの.Net対応版だということがわかりました。しかし、マイクロソフトのダウンロードセンターを見てみても、どれが(あるいはどのバージョンが).Net対応なのか、どれがManagedなのか、よくわかりません。 いったいどれがManagedで.Net対応版なのでしょうか? http://www.microsoft.com/downloads/Search.aspx?displaylang=ja くだらない事ですみませんが、よろしく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• canonbowl
  • ベストアンサー率41% (14/34)
回答No.2

1.リリース年月以降であれば、経験上、日本語ページでも英語ページでもどちらでも良い(機能する)と思います。ただ、英語ページのリリースが早いので、早くソフトを使いたい場合は英語ページからダウンロードしています。 2..NET Frameworkが必須、開発にはDirectX 9.0 SDKが必要と読めるので、DirectX 9.0と.NET Frameworkがインストールされていれば良いと考えます。

subarist00
質問者

お礼

>リリース年月以降であれば、経験上、日本語ページでも英語ページでもどちらでも良い(機能する)と思います。 貴重な情報ありがとうございます。言語の違いは単純にインストールウィザードの案内が日本語化されているかどうかの違いのような気もしますが、正直なところよくわかりません。ただ、かつてSQLサーバーの時には「日本語Windows上で海外開発のアプリ」の組み合わせのときに、日本語のSQLサーバーのみ不可、という経験があり、神経質になっています。 2.と言う事は、単純に.NET Frameworkに加えてDirectX9.0のなるべく新しいものを入れておけばいいということですね。 ありがとうございます。

その他の回答 (1)

  • canonbowl
  • ベストアンサー率41% (14/34)
回答No.1

.NET Framework用のAPI、初めて知りました。情報ありがとう。

参考URL:
http://msdn.microsoft.com/library/ja/default.asp?url=/library/ja/DirectX9_m/directx/dx9intro.asp
subarist00
質問者

お礼

ご回答ありがとうございます。

関連するQ&A

  • DirectX SDKのダウンロード

    DirectXのSDKというものを導入すればゲームが作れると聞きました。 そこで早速マイクロソフトのサイトにおとしにいきました。 http://www.microsoft.com/japan/msdn/directx/downloads.aspx とりあえずDirectX9のSDKをおとしたいのですが どれを選べばいいのか分かりません(汗) 一番下にある以前のバージョンの DirectX SDK と日本語ドキュメント という箇所がそれらしいのですが、 適当にクリックしても英語のサイトへ行ってしまい、 とても日本語版のダウンロードの雰囲気ではありません。 とりあえずそこのoctober2004というのをおとしてみました。 500Mもある巨大なファイルなのでそうかなとも思いましたが、 他のUPDATEには170Mのものがあったりと パッチなのか、日本語版なのかも全然分からず躊躇しています。 何か間違っている気がするのですが、これでよいのでしょうか?

  • DirectX について

    自作PCを使用してます。最新版のDirectXをマイクロソフト社からダウンロードしても古いマザーボードですと機能しない様ですが「このマザーボードはDirectXのどのバージョンまで対応しているか?」というのはどうすれば調べる事ができますか?お詳しい方、宜しく御願い致します。

  • DirectX エンド ユーザー ランタイム Web インストーラについて

    現在、私のパソコンは、 Windows Vista Service Pack 2 DirectX11 なのですが、メタセコイアで使いたいプラグインを使うためには 最新のDirectXにする必要があるのです。 下記のページのエンドユーザーランタイムをインストールすると 最新の状態になりますか? ​http://www.microsoft.com/downloads/details.aspx?displaylang=ja&FamilyID=2da43d38-db71-4c1b-bc6a-9b6652cd92a3 (DirectX エンド ユーザー ランタイム Web インストーラ) バージョン : 9.28.1886 公開された日付 : 2010/02/05 このページの必要システムに、Windows Vistaとはあるものの、 Service Pack 2とは書かれていないのですがいいでしょうか? また、私のDirectXのバージョンは11なのですが、 もし、DirectXのバージョンが10や他のバージョンだったとしても、 この同じエンドユーザーランタイムをインストールしてもOKなんでしょうか? どうしてDirectXのバージョンは書いてないのかなと不思議だったのですが、ランタイムにDirectXのバージョンは関係ないのですか? もう一つ、このページの追加情報に、 「DirectX 9.0c コア ランタイムを再インストールする必要がある場合は、DirectX Redist の使用をお勧めします。」 とありますが、DirectX 9.0c コア ランタイムを再インストールするとはどういう状況なのでしょうか? DirectX Redist の方の、 DirectX End-User Runtimes (February 2010)は、 英語バージョンみたいですが、 日本語版のDirectX エンド ユーザー ランタイム Web インストーラとはなにが違うのでしょうか? よくわからないですけど、DirectX 9.0c コア ランタイムもインストールしてくれる、 DirectX End-User Runtimes (February 2010)の方がお得な感じがするのですが (といっても、DirectX 9.0c コア ランタイムの意味もわからないのですが…)どっちでもいいのでしょうか? 日本語版と英語版の違いや気をつけることなどありますか? (一度英語バージョンをインストールすると、次回からも英語バージョンしかインストールできない、など) よろしくお願いします。

  • DirectXをアップグレードできない

    はじめまして、こんばんは。 この度PCを新規で組みました。問題なく動作はするのですがDirectXのバージョンが古く新しいバージョンに更新できません。 使用環境は以下の通りです CPU:Q6600 メモリ:2G*2 OS:Microsoft Windows XP Media Center Edition 2005 ファイル名を指定して実行「dxdiag」を押しシステム欄を見ると DirectXバージョン:DirectX7.0(4.07.0000.0000)と出ます。 http://www.microsoft.com/downloads/details.aspx?familyid=9226A611-62FE-4F61-ABA1-914185249413&displaylang=ja 上記ページよりDirectX 9.0cをダウンロードして普通にインストールが完了しても再びファイル名を指定して実行「dxdiag」を押しシステム欄を見るとDirectXバージョン:DirectX7.0(4.07.0000.0000)と出ます。 DirectX 9.0cをインストールしたときに インストール完了 インストールされたコンポーネントを使用する準備ができました。 と出ているにもかかわらずDirectX 9.0cが使用できずにDirectX 7.0のままなのは何が原因として考えられますでしょうか? 何かアドバイスがあればよろしくお願いします。

  • どちらをインストールすれば…

    最近、正規の英語版XP-Proを日本語表示対応にして使い始めました。 教えて頂きたい点が二つあります。 1.WindowsUpdateでDirectXのダウンロードが可能のようですが、自分のPCにインストールされているバージョンの確認方法(これは、OSが英語版であることに関係ありませんが…) 2.ダウンロードする場合、英語版と日本語版のどちらを選択すればいいのでしょうか(英語版のXPで、マイクロソフトの日本語サイトからダウンロードしようとしている状態です) 以上2点、宜しくお願いします。

  • directXのバージョンはどこを比較すればいいのでしょうか?

    directXを最新にしたいのですが バージョンの見方がわかりません。 まずファイル名を指定して実行 →dxdiag →DirectXバージョン:DirectX 9.0C(4.09.0000.0904) まで確認しました。 続いてmicrosoftのページまでたどり着いたのですが↓ http://www.microsoft.com/downloads/details.aspx?FamilyID=2da43d38-db71-4c1b-bc6a-9b6652cd92a3&DisplayLang=ja どこを見れば最新かどうかわかるのでしょうか? 9.0C(4.09.0000.0904) みたいなのが見当たらないのですが…。 見当違いのページを見てるのでしょうか?

  • DirectXのページが…

    DirectXをダウンロードしたいのですが、公式HPのダウンロードページ http://www.microsoft.com/downloads/details.aspx にアクセスしたら英語で「ない」というような答えが返ってきました。どうすればダウンロードできるようになるのでしょうか?

  • DirectX10とは?

    ビデオカードの外箱にDirectX10対応と書いてありましたが、 DirectX10って何でしょうか? DirectXのダウンロードページに行っても最新版として書かれているのは9.0cなのですが? DirectX10って何なのでしょうか?

  • DirectXのバージョンの違い

    OSはwindows xpを使ってます。 DirectXを使おうと思いダウンロードページを見た所、「Microsoft DirectX SDK (Mar 2008) 」が最新のバージョンとの事です。 そこで、いくつか疑問点があるので質問させてもらいます。 ・最新という事は、これがDirectX10ですか? ・このSDKで作ったアプリはwindows2000で動きますか? ・日本語ヘルプが「october 2004」以降出てないようですけど、最新のバージョンに対応した日本語ヘルプはまだ出てないのでしょうか?  出てないのでしたら、「october 2004」がヘルプとして使えるバージョンはいつの物になりますか? どうかよろしくお願いします。

  • DirectX 9.0c End-User Runtimeのダウンロードができない

    http://www.microsoft.com/downloads/details.aspx?displaylang=ja&FamilyID=0a9b6820-bfbb-4799-9908-d418cdeac197                    このページからダウンロードをするとおもうのですが、ダウンロードという文字がありません。どうにかDirectX 9.0c End-User Runtimeをダウンロードする方法はないですか?ほかのページからダウンロードできる場所とかはありますか?なんでもいいので教えて下さい。

専門家に質問してみよう